What is Cyclopentolate Hydrochloride?
ODAN-CYCLOPENTOLATE 1% is an ophthalmic solution used to dilate the pupils. This medication is commonly prescribed for eye examinations and certain eye conditions. It contains cyclopentolate hydrochloride, a potent anticholinergic agent.
What is Cyclopentolate Hydrochloride used for?
ODAN-CYCLOPENTOLATE 1% is primarily used to dilate the pupils, a process known as mydriasis. This is often necessary for comprehensive eye examinations to allow the eye care professional to view the retina and other internal structures more clearly. Additionally, it may be used to manage certain eye conditions that require pupil dilation. Cyclopentolate hydrochloride works by temporarily paralyzing the muscles that control pupil size, resulting in dilation. What are the side effects of Cyclopentolate Hydrochloride?
Common effects of ODAN-CYCLOPENTOLATE 1% may include temporary blurred vision, sensitivity to light, and a burning or stinging sensation upon application. These effects are usually short-lived and resolve as the medication wears off. Some users may also experience dry mouth or mild headaches. If any of these effects persist or worsen, it is advisable to consult a healthcare professional.
What precautions apply to Cyclopentolate Hydrochloride?
When using ODAN-CYCLOPENTOLATE 1%, it is important to avoid touching the tip of the dropper to prevent contamination. Store the solution at room temperature and keep it out of reach of children. Do not use this medication if you are allergic to cyclopentolate hydrochloride or any of its ingredients. Always follow the instructions provided by your healthcare professional for safe and effective use.
What does Cyclopentolate Hydrochloride interact with?
ODAN-CYCLOPENTOLATE 1% may interact with other medications, particularly those that affect the central nervous system or have anticholinergic properties. It is important to inform your healthcare professional about all medications you are currently taking, including prescription and over-the-counter drugs, as well as herbal supplements. Alcohol consumption should be avoided while using this medication, as it may enhance certain side effects.
